THE POSITIONThe City is looking to fill a Part-time, Temporary/Seasonal Information Technology (IT) Support Assistant to assist the IT team in everyday functions and tasks. As the first point of contact for City staff, this position will ensure City employees have the tools they need to serve the community effectively. This role will be on-site IT support help and will assist with a variety of specialized computer issues, such as triaging incoming help desk tickets, prioritizing needs, and providing staff with updates regarding their IT help requests. This dynamic role will also focus on communicating with City staff to provide solutions to technology issues and assisting with access issues, such as password reset, network folder permissions, login difficulties, troubleshooting basic printer/network connectivity (such as WIFI, Ethernet, web browsers, and VPN connections), and Office 365 desktop/cloud app issues. The IT Support Desk plays a pivotal role in deploying, maintaining, and/or replacing physical hardware such as smart devices, uninterruptible power supplies, laptops, desktops, scanners, and stationary cameras.
